Subject: Orders soft-delete cut-over — summary for eng sync

Team, the Quillbarn orders table now uses soft deletes as of last night's cut-over. Hard deletes are disabled, the purge job runs nightly, and dashboards were updated to filter tombstoned rows. No rollback needed. The retention and purge behavior is driven by the settings below.

deployment values, yahag-tawef:
ZORWYN_HOST=zorwyn.tolvaqlabs.internal
ZORWYN_PORT=9300

## Authentication

Before hammering the Cartwhistle checkout flow with load tests, you'll need a token scoped to the synthetic-orders project. Don't reuse production creds — the gateway will flag them and page someone at 3 a.m. For staging runs, stick the token below into your Authorization header and you're good to go.

portal login ticket: eyJhbGciOiJIUzI1NiIsInR5cCI6IkpXVCJ9.eyJzdWIiOiIMjvRAf3PEFIn0.nuv9gjixLtnr

### Broker upgrade: Pelicanwire 4.x

When upgrading the Pelicanwire broker from 3.9 to 4.x, drain consumers first and snapshot the offsets ledger; the new storage format is not backward compatible, and a partial migration leaves orphaned partitions. Future maintainers should run the compatibility checker against each node before restarting, then verify replication lag returns to zero within ten minutes. The migration tool authenticates against the admin plane using the bearer token given below.

session JWT of yawep-yawep = eyJhbGciOiJIUzI1NiIsInR5cCI6IkpXVCJ9.eyJzdWIiOiI3pWF3_In0.aXYsHiog

## Tuning

The Stocktally reconciliation job chews through the Verran warehouse ledger nightly, and the defaults are deliberately conservative. If the run is creeping past the 2 a.m. cutoff, bump the batch size before touching parallelism — workers contend on the ledger lock. Anything beyond these knobs needs a sign-off from the data team. Current values:

tuning table, yajog-yahof:
BUDGETS = {
    "lamvan": 303,
    "wenox": 460,
    "fenvan": 525,
}